To find the number of gun deaths in specific years using the equation y = -1777x + 27,153, where x represents the number of years after 2000, you need to substitute the corresponding values of x into the equation.

For 2004, x would be 4 since it is four years after 2000. Plugging this value into the equation:

y = -1777(4) + 27,153

y = -7108 + 27,153

y ≈ 20,045

Therefore, the predicted number of gun deaths in 2004 is approximately 20,045.

Similarly, for 2008, x would be 8:

y = -1777(8) + 27,153

y = -14,216 + 27,153

y ≈ 12,937

Thus, the predicted number of gun deaths in 2008 is approximately 12,937.

To find the year when the number of gun deaths will be 9,383, you can rearrange the equation as follows:

9383 = -1777x + 27,153

Subtract 27,153 from both sides:

-17,770 = -1777x

Divide both sides by -1777:

x ≈ 10

Since x represents the number of years after 2000, you add 10 years to 2000 to find the corresponding year:

2000 + 10 = 2010

Therefore, the number of gun deaths is predicted to be 9,383 in the year 2010.
